AMSTERDAM (Reuters) – Former Liverpool striker and Netherlands worldwide Dirk Kuyt was named the new coach of ADO Den Haag on Thursday, tasked with serving to the side again to the highest flight of Dutch soccer after they missed out on promotion in a playoff on the weekend.

He is the fifth coach in three years for the membership, relegated final yr, and takes up his first senior function after beforehand teaching Feyenoord’s under-19 side.

“Pretty soon after my playing career ended, it was my ambition to become a coach. I have invested in that in recent years and now this opportunity has presented itself,” the 41-year-old Kuyt stated at his presentation on Thursday.

Kuyt has been advised the membership’s ambitions are a return to the Eredivisie.

“That’s a critical purpose, however I prefer it. ADO is a sleeping large, it actually appeals to me to begin as a coach there and to develop. I see it as an unlimited problem to convey ADO again to the place it belongs,” he added.

Den Haag misplaced on penalties after a 4-4 draw with Excelsior Rotterdam of their promotion playoff match on Sunday, sparking crowd hassle.

Kuyt performed greater than 200 video games at Liverpool and in addition gained the Turkish league title at Fenerbahce. He gained 104 caps for the Dutch, taking part in on the World Cups in 2006, 2010 and 2014.
